The Chinese electric car startup WM Motor has been able to generate nearly 400 million euros in a financing round led by Baidu. Other investors in the new round are Linear Venture and the Taihang Industrial Fund.

The fresh capital should flow primarily into research and development. Among other things, Weimar Motors and Baidu are preparing a common research center for the development of autonomous driving solutions. 

In the spring of 2018, the company started selling the Electric-SUV in China. Three battery variants are available for ranges of 300, 400 or 460 kilometers.
